Understanding Exhaust Sensor Systems

Exhaust sensor systems, such as oxygen sensors and NOx sensors, monitor the emissions produced by your vehicle’s engine. These sensors provide data to the engine control unit (ECU) to optimize fuel combustion and reduce harmful emissions. Over time, sensors can degrade, leading to inaccurate readings and potential compliance issues.
